New Holland T9.470 Summary
The New Holland T9.470 is a 2024 model from the T9 Series, built in Fargo, North Dakota, USA. It offers an engine gross power of 419.2 hp and a maximum engine power of 460.6 hp.
New Holland T9.470 Horsepower, Weight, and Specifications:
Production
Who is the manufacturer and where is the tractor built?
- Manufacturer: New Holland (a part of CNH)
- Type: Four-wheel Drive (4WD) tractor
- Build Location: Fargo, North Dakota, USA
Engine
What are the engine specifications?
- Engine: FPT 12.9L 6-cyl diesel
- Fuel tank: 310 gal (1173.4 L)
- Exhaust fluid (DEF): 42 gal (159.0 L)
Transmissions
What types of transmissions are available?
- 17-speed full power shift
- Continuously-variable transmission
Horsepower
What is the horsepower range?
- Engine (gross): 419.2 hp (312.6 kW)
- Engine (max): 460.6 hp (343.5 kW)
- PTO (claimed): 403.4 hp (300.8 kW)
Mechanical
What are the mechanical features?
- Four-wheel drive
- Final drives: planetary
- Differential lock: automatic front and rear
- Articulated power steering
- Brakes: hydraulic wet disc and engine brake
- Cab standard with air-conditioning
Hydraulics
What are the hydraulics specifications?
- Type: closed center
- Pump flow:
- 42 gpm (159.0 lpm)
- 57 gpm Optional (215.7 lpm)
- 98 gpm Optional (370.9 lpm)
- 113 gpm Optional (427.7 lpm)
Tractor Hitch
What are the specifications of the tractor hitch?
- Rear Type: IVN/III
- Rear lift (at 24"/610mm): 20000 lbs (9072 kg)
- Drawbar: Cat 4 (Cat 5 Optional)
Power Take-off (PTO)
What are the PTO specifications?
- Rear PTO: independent
- Rear PTO Type: 1000 (1.75)
- Engine RPM: 1000@1811
Dimensions & Tires
What are the dimensions and tires specifications?
- Wheelbase: 148 inches (375 cm)
- Weight: 40800 lbs (18506 kg)
Electrical
What are the electrical specifications?
- Ground: negative
- Charging system: alternator
- Charging amps:
- 240
- 330 Optional
- Batteries: 3
- Battery CCA: 950
- Battery volts: 12
